Sign In — Free (10 views/day)NATIONAL INSTITUTE AND ASSOCIATION FOR MINORITIES, founded in 2019, is a small nonprofit that reported $827K in total revenue in fiscal year 2020. Revenue surged 5985% from the prior year, signaling strong growth momentum. The organization ran a surplus of $357K, a strong 43% operating margin.
To help underprivileged youth who live in poverty have access to higher education by providing grants, scholarships and training.
SUPPORT GIFTED AND TALENTED CHILDREN IN POVERTY AND SUPPORT MINORITY WOMEN IN PROVERTY.
